How to Clear History from Android?

Clearing your Android browser history is a relatively simple process, and you can do it in a few steps:

Method 1: Clear Browser History through Browser Settings

  • Open your Android browser (e.g., Google Chrome, Mozilla Firefox, Safari)
  • Tap the three vertical dots or lines at the top right corner
  • Tap "Settings"
  • Scroll down to "Privacy" or "Security" section
  • Tap "Clear Browsing Data"
  • Choose the data you want to clear (e.g., browsing history, search history, cookies, etc.)
  • Tap "Clear" or "OK" to confirm

Method 2: Clear History using Android Device’s Built-in Settings

  • Go to your Android device’s "Settings" app
  • Scroll down and tap "Apps" or "Application Manager"
  • Find your browser (e.g., Google Chrome, Mozilla Firefox, etc.) and tap it
  • Tap "Clear data" or "Clear cache"
  • Confirm that you want to clear the data or cache

Additional Tips to Secure Your Android Browser

  • Clear Cache and Cookies Regularly: Clearing your browser’s cache and cookies regularly can help protect your online identity and prevent data breaches.
  • Use Incognito Mode: Enable incognito mode whenever you’re using your browser to prevent your browsing history from being saved.
  • Use a Secure Search Engine: Use a search engine that offers private browsing features, such as DuckDuckGo or StartPage.
  • Keep Your Browser Up-to-Date: Regularly update your browser to the latest version to ensure you have the latest security patches and features.
